Breakfast Protein Biscuits

  • Total Time: 26 minutes
  • Yield: 10 biscuits

Ingredients

  • 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 cup unflavored or vanilla protein powder
  • 2 tsp baking powder
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1/2 cup Greek yogurt
  • 1/2 cup cottage cheese
  • 2 large eggs
  • 2 tbsp melted butter (plus more for brushing)


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 400°F and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Whisk together flour protein powder baking powder and salt in a bowl.
  3. Add Greek yogurt cottage cheese eggs and butter and mix until a dough forms.
  4. Turn out dough on floured surface and pat into 1-inch thickness.
  5. Cut out biscuits using a cutter and place on baking sheet.
  6. Brush tops with melted butter and bake 14–16 minutes until golden brown.
  7. Cool slightly and serve warm or store in an airtight container.

Notes

  • Add herbs shredded cheese or turkey bacon for variety.
  • If dough is too dry add a tablespoon of milk at a time.
  • Use gluten-free flour and protein for a GF version.
